[PATCH V5 1/2] mmc: sdhci-msm: Add support to store supported vdd-io voltages

From: Vijay Viswanath
Date: Fri Apr 20 2018 - 08:15:58 EST


During probe check whether the vdd-io regulator of sdhc platform device
can support 1.8V and 3V and store this information as a capability of
platform device.

+static void sdhci_msm_set_regulator_caps(struct sdhci_msm_host *msm_host)
+{
+ struct mmc_host *mmc = msm_host->mmc;
+ struct regulator *supply = mmc->supply.vqmmc;
+ u32 caps = 0;
+
+ if (!IS_ERR(mmc->supply.vqmmc)) {
+ if (regulator_is_supported_voltage(supply, 1700000, 1950000))
+ caps |= CORE_1_8V_SUPPORT;
+ if (regulator_is_supported_voltage(supply, 2700000, 3600000))
+ caps |= CORE_3_0V_SUPPORT;
+
+ if (!caps)
+ pr_warn("%s: 1.8/3V not supported for vqmmc\n",
+ mmc_hostname(mmc));
+ }
+
+ msm_host->caps_0 |= caps;
+ pr_debug("%s: supported caps: 0x%08x\n", mmc_hostname(mmc), caps);
+}
